Output d62b79397c03540e9788c345b16ad4705909cba0dcd2a9a10833841eda7a92bf:0

value
642841
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cb51c8df8474bd2b63eed50cdff7b510c56e3da OP_EQUAL
address
37E1RuPa1BX3911xfGZcUmCCtRP5CfqaXy
transaction
d62b79397c03540e9788c345b16ad4705909cba0dcd2a9a10833841eda7a92bf
spent
true